2. Aeration and Drainage: Coconut fiber substrate offers optimal aeration and drainage for plant roots. Its fibrous construction creates air pockets, facilitating oxygen circulation and stopping soil compaction. This enhanced aeration promotes sturdy root development, making certain more healthy and more resilient vegetation. Additionally, coconut fiber substrate permits for environment friendly drainage, reducing the risk of overwatering and root rot.

Compressed coco coir refers to coco coir that has been compacted into convenient blocks or discs for ease of storage and transportation. These blocks are created by compressing the fibrous materials derived from coconut husks. When hydrated, the compressed coco coir expands and transforms into a usable rising medium. This compressed type makes it a handy and space-saving possibility for gardeners.

One of the important thing advantages of compressed coco coir is its distinctive water retention capability. The fibrous structure of coco coir allows it to hold and release moisture successfully, offering a constant water supply to plant roots. This function is very useful in areas with limited water availability or for crops that require consistent moisture ranges. Compressed coco coir helps cut back water wastage and ensures vegetation receive adequate hydration.

2. Crop Diversity: Organic farms encourage biodiversity by rising a wide range of crops and avoiding monoculture (growing a single crop). Crop rotation and mixed cropping are common practices in organic farming, which assist break pest and illness cycles naturally, improve soil nutrient steadiness, and supply habitat for helpful insects and wildlife.
